Painting Description
"Portrait of Miss Hunter" is a captivating work by the renowned American artist John Singer Sargent, celebrated for his exceptional skill in portraiture. Sargent, born in 1856, was one of the leading portrait painters of his generation, known for his ability to capture the essence and personality of his subjects with remarkable precision and elegance.
The painting, created in the late 19th or early 20th century, exemplifies Sargent's masterful use of light, shadow, and texture. "Portrait of Miss Hunter" features a young woman, Miss Hunter, whose identity and background remain largely enigmatic. The portrait is characterized by Sargent's signature style, which combines a realistic representation with a sense of spontaneity and fluidity. The subject is depicted with a poised and graceful demeanor, her gaze directed slightly away from the viewer, adding a sense of introspection and depth to the composition.
Sargent's technique in this portrait is notable for its loose brushwork and the subtle interplay of light and color, which bring a lifelike quality to Miss Hunter's complexion and attire. The background is rendered with a soft focus, ensuring that the viewer's attention remains firmly on the subject. The artist's ability to convey the texture of fabrics and the delicate features of Miss Hunter's face demonstrates his exceptional skill and attention to detail.
"Portrait of Miss Hunter" is a testament to Sargent's enduring legacy as a portraitist who could capture not just the physical likeness but also the inner life of his subjects. This work, like many of Sargent's portraits, offers a glimpse into the social and cultural milieu of the time, reflecting the elegance and sophistication of the late Victorian and Edwardian eras. The painting continues to be admired for its artistic excellence and remains an important piece within Sargent's extensive body of work.
